Order of Dismissal or Administrative Closure
ORDER: The parties inform the Court that they have "agreed on the terms of settlement in principle, which would fully resolve this matter." Thus, the parties ask the Court to allow them 60 days to finalize the settlement. The Court, finding good cause, grants the motion - Dkt No. 36. All outstanding deadlines are vacated. The parties are ordered to file either a joint stipulation of dismissal pursuant to Federal Rule of Civil Procedure 41(a)(1)(A)(ii) and a proposed order or a joint status report regarding the settlement by September 8, 2026. The Clerk of Court is directed to administratively close this case for statistical purposes without prejudice to it being reopened to enter a judgment or order of dismissal or for further proceedings if the settlement is not consummated. The defendant's pending motion for Rule 11 sanctions (Dkt. No. 19) is denied as moot without prejudice to refiling. The clerk will prepare the final Report to the Patent/Trademark or Copyright Office. (Ordered by Judge James Wesley Hendrix on 7/6/2026) (bdg)
